Grants paid by The Hampshire Foundation, tax year 2022

EIN 84-1523630 · Denver, GA · Form 990-PF, Part XV · NTEE T22

In tax year 2022, The Hampshire Foundation (EIN 84-1523630) reported 6 grants paid totaling $294,000. D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
